Jigawa, Ondo Top States In Latest Fiscal Transparency Assessment

Jigawa and Ondo States have clinched the top positions in the second quarter (Q2) 2023 States Fiscal Transparency Assessment, according to a report published by the civic organisation, BudgIT. The report showcases these states’ exceptional commitment to fiscal transparency and accountability.
